What is a Rational Fraction?

At its core, a rational fraction is a fraction where both the numerator (the top number) and the denominator (the bottom number) are integers, and the denominator is not zero. An integer is a whole number that can be positive, negative, or zero. This seemingly simple definition encompasses a vast range of numbers and mathematical operations.

As an example, ½, ¾, -2/5, and 10/1 are all rational fractions. The key is that the numerator and denominator are both whole numbers, and the denominator isn't zero (division by zero is undefined in mathematics). Which means numbers like π (pi) and √2 (the square root of 2) are not rational fractions because they cannot be expressed as a ratio of two integers. These are examples of irrational numbers.

Think of a rational fraction as representing a part of a whole. If you have a pizza cut into 8 slices, and you eat 3 slices, you've eaten 3/8 of the pizza. The numerator (3) represents the number of slices you ate, and the denominator (8) represents the total number of slices.

Types of Rational Fractions

Rational fractions can be categorized in several ways:

  • Proper Fractions: In a proper fraction, the numerator is smaller than the denominator. Examples include ½, ¾, and 2/5. These fractions represent a value less than 1.

  • Improper Fractions: In an improper fraction, the numerator is greater than or equal to the denominator. Examples include 5/2, 7/3, and 8/8. These fractions represent a value greater than or equal to 1.

  • Mixed Numbers: A mixed number combines a whole number and a proper fraction. To give you an idea, 1 ½, 2 ¾, and 3 ⅕ are mixed numbers. These are essentially another way of representing improper fractions.

Converting Between Fractions, Decimals, and Percentages

Rational fractions can be easily converted into decimals and percentages, and vice versa. This flexibility is crucial for various applications.

  • Fraction to Decimal: To convert a fraction to a decimal, simply divide the numerator by the denominator. As an example, ½ = 1 ÷ 2 = 0.5; ¾ = 3 ÷ 4 = 0.75.

  • Fraction to Percentage: Multiply the decimal equivalent of the fraction by 100%. As an example, ½ = 0.5 * 100% = 50%; ¾ = 0.75 * 100% = 75%.

  • Decimal to Fraction: For terminating decimals (decimals that end), identify the place value of the last digit. Write the decimal as a fraction with the decimal value as the numerator and the corresponding place value as the denominator. Simplify the fraction if possible. To give you an idea, 0.25 = 25/100 = ¼; 0.125 = 125/1000 = ⅛. Recurring decimals (decimals that repeat infinitely) require a different approach, often involving algebraic manipulation.

  • Percentage to Fraction: Divide the percentage by 100% and simplify the resulting fraction. To give you an idea, 50% = 50/100 = ½; 75% = 75/100 = ¾.

Operations with Rational Fractions

Performing mathematical operations (addition, subtraction, multiplication, and division) with rational fractions requires understanding specific rules and techniques.

  • Adding and Subtracting Fractions: To add or subtract fractions, they must have a common denominator. If they don't, find the least common multiple (LCM) of the denominators and convert the fractions accordingly. Then, add or subtract the numerators while keeping the common denominator. For example:

    1/2 + 1/4 = (2/4) + (1/4) = 3/4

    2/3 - 1/6 = (4/6) - (1/6) = 3/6 = 1/2

  • Multiplying Fractions: Multiplying fractions is straightforward. Multiply the numerators together and multiply the denominators together. Simplify the resulting fraction if possible. For example:

    1/2 * 1/4 = 1/8

    2/3 * 3/4 = 6/12 = 1/2

  • Dividing Fractions: To divide fractions, invert (reciprocate) the second fraction (the divisor) and then multiply. For example:

    1/2 ÷ 1/4 = 1/2 * 4/1 = 4/2 = 2

    2/3 ÷ 3/4 = 2/3 * 4/3 = 8/9

Simplifying Rational Fractions

Simplifying, or reducing, a fraction means expressing it in its lowest terms. This is done by finding the greatest common divisor (GCD) of the numerator and denominator and dividing both by it. For example:

6/12 = (6 ÷ 6) / (12 ÷ 6) = 1/2

Q: What happens if the denominator of a fraction is zero?

A: Division by zero is undefined in mathematics. A fraction with a denominator of zero is not a valid mathematical expression.

Q: How do I compare the size of two fractions?

A: Find a common denominator for both fractions. The fraction with the larger numerator is the larger fraction. Alternatively, convert both fractions to decimals and compare the decimal values.

Q: Can a rational fraction be expressed as a decimal that goes on forever?

A: Yes, but only if the decimal is repeating. Non-repeating, infinitely long decimals are irrational numbers.
